Transaction 3af59a74041d7399f98772e81f7b0b724a958db2da19d68c77d878003717d948

2 Input
2 Outputs
  • 3af59a74041d7399f98772e81f7b0b724a958db2da19d68c77d878003717d948:0
  • value  18423
    address  18PR47iiexyUsM4b1cXN84L8ijoyDnFeHh
  • 3af59a74041d7399f98772e81f7b0b724a958db2da19d68c77d878003717d948:1
  • value  44140
    address  33Ltt98tL3bVrw9yH6qrXH3utUsa89rxsZ